Buzzard and Continental Cormorant, Tralee

First calendar year Buzzard, Tralee, 1st December 2016 (M.O'Clery).

This approachable bird has been present in hedgerow close to an industrial estate on the outskirts of Tralee for two weeks now. It is actively hunting by perching on low bushes, gates and trees and dropping down to the ground and seems to be mainly after rats, though there are also plenty of rabbits in the area.

It can be aged as a first year on a number of features, such as the uniform age of the wing feathers (i.e., no moult 'gaps'), and the pale tips to some coverts, as well as the finely barred tail tip (darker band at the tip on adults), and on a face-on view, the more vertical streaking on the breast (more horizontal barring on adults).
